Women's haircut with a buzzed nape
 
This bold, androgynous pixie cut embodies the daring spirit of 1980s fashion-forward hairstyling. The cut features dramatically short sides and back, clipper-cut close to the head to create a clean edge, while the top is left substantially longer for striking contrast.
 
The length on top is swept to the side in a voluminous wave that showcases both texture and movement, creating an asymmetric silhouette. The styling of the longer section is key to this look's success. The hair is directed diagonally across the head, with strategic lift at the roots creating height and dimension.
 
The ends are textured and piece-y, preventing the longer section from appearing too heavy or overwhelming. This careful balance between the close-cropped perimeter and the generous length on top creates a dynamic, eye-catching effect that's both edgy and sophisticated.
 
The coloring technique adds another layer to this already striking cut. Warm brown base tones are enhanced with lighter caramel highlights concentrated through the longer top section, creating depth and emphasizing the hair's natural movement. The close-cropped sides and back showcase the natural darker tones, which helps frame the face.

This cut is perfect for those who want to make a statement. Despite its bold appearance, it's surprisingly easy to style with just a bit of volumizing mousse worked through damp hair, blow-dried with fingers for lift, and finished with a light-hold product to maintain the perfectly tousled texture throughout the day.
